#include "bpfilter.h"
#include <sys/param.h>
#include <sys/systm.h>
#include <sys/mbuf.h>
#include <sys/socket.h>
#include <sys/ioctl.h>
#include <sys/errno.h>
#include <sys/syslog.h>
#include <sys/timeout.h>
#include <sys/device.h>
#include <net/if.h>
#include <net/if_media.h>
#include <netinet/in.h>
#include <netinet/if_ether.h>
#if NBPFILTER > 0
#include <net/bpf.h>
#endif
#include <machine/intr.h>
#include <machine/bus.h>
#include <dev/mii/mii.h>
#include <dev/mii/miivar.h>
#include <dev/ic/smc91cxxreg.h>
#include <dev/ic/smc91cxxvar.h>
#include <dev/isa/isavar.h>
int sm_isa_match(struct device *, void *, void *);
void sm_isa_attach(struct device *, struct device *, void *);
struct sm_isa_softc {
struct smc91cxx_softc sc_smc;
void *sc_ih;
};
const struct cfattach sm_isa_ca = {
sizeof(struct sm_isa_softc), sm_isa_match, sm_isa_attach
};
int
sm_isa_match(struct device *parent, void *match, void *aux)
{
struct isa_attach_args *ia = aux;
bus_space_tag_t iot = ia->ia_iot;
bus_space_handle_t ioh;
u_int16_t tmp;
int rv = 0;
extern const char *smc91cxx_idstrs[];
if (ia->ia_irq == -1)
return (0);
if (ia->ia_iobase == -1)
return (0);
if (bus_space_map(iot, ia->ia_iobase, SMC_IOSIZE, 0, &ioh))
return (0);
tmp = bus_space_read_2(iot, ioh, BANK_SELECT_REG_W);
if ((tmp & BSR_DETECT_MASK) != BSR_DETECT_VALUE)
goto out;
bus_space_write_2(iot, ioh, BANK_SELECT_REG_W, 0);
tmp = bus_space_read_2(iot, ioh, BANK_SELECT_REG_W);
if ((tmp & BSR_DETECT_MASK) != BSR_DETECT_VALUE)
goto out;
bus_space_write_2(iot, ioh, BANK_SELECT_REG_W, 1);
tmp = bus_space_read_2(iot, ioh, BASE_ADDR_REG_W);
if (ia->ia_iobase != ((tmp >> 3) & 0x3e0))
goto out;
bus_space_write_2(iot, ioh, BANK_SELECT_REG_W, 3);
tmp = bus_space_read_2(iot, ioh, REVISION_REG_W);
if (smc91cxx_idstrs[RR_ID(tmp)] == NULL)
goto out;
ia->ia_iosize = SMC_IOSIZE;
rv = 1;
out:
bus_space_unmap(iot, ioh, SMC_IOSIZE);
return (rv);
}
void
sm_isa_attach(struct device *parent, struct device *self, void *aux)
{
struct sm_isa_softc *isc = (struct sm_isa_softc *)self;
struct smc91cxx_softc *sc = &isc->sc_smc;
struct isa_attach_args *ia = aux;
bus_space_tag_t iot = ia->ia_iot;
bus_space_handle_t ioh;
printf("\n");
if (bus_space_map(iot, ia->ia_iobase, ia->ia_iosize, 0, &ioh))
panic("sm_isa_attach: can't map i/o space");
sc->sc_bst = iot;
sc->sc_bsh = ioh;
sc->sc_enabled = 1;
smc91cxx_attach(sc, NULL);
isc->sc_ih = isa_intr_establish(ia->ia_ic, ia->ia_irq, IST_EDGE,
IPL_NET, smc91cxx_intr, sc, sc->sc_dev.dv_xname);
if (isc->sc_ih == NULL)
printf("%s: couldn't establish interrupt handler\n",
sc->sc_dev.dv_xname);
}
